  • Abstract
    The authors describe the fundamental characteristics of compact stepped impedance hairpin resonators with parallel coupled lines, and show their application to voltage-controlled push-push oscillators for UHF band operation. The experimental push-push oscillators built using these resonators provide low phase noise and wide tuning operation.<>
